The meat of this patch is in BuildCXXMemberCalLExpr where we make it use
MarkMemberReferenced instead of marking functions referenced directly. An audit
of callers to MarkFunctionReferenced and DiagnoseUseOfDecl also caused a few
other changes:
 * don't mark functions odr-used when considering them for an initialization
   sequence. Do mark them referenced though.
 * the function nominated by the cleanup attribute should be diagnosed.
 * operator new/delete should be diagnosed when building a 'new' expression.
